Problem
Current wireless communication systems face challenges in accurately measuring and managing Channel Occupancy Ratio (CR) in user equipment, particularly in scenarios where resource pools change, leading to incomplete or inaccurate CR measurements.
Innovation Solution
A method and apparatus for user equipment to measure and transmit CR by evaluating the number of subchannels within a predetermined interval that includes both past and future time frames, allowing for effective CR measurement and transmission parameter adjustments such as transmit power, subchannel size, and retransmission count.

One embodiment of the present invention relates to a method of measuring and transmitting a Channel occupancy Ratio (CR) by a user equipment in a wireless communication system, the method including measuring the CR evaluated as the number of subchannels related to a transmission of the UE in an interval in a predetermined size and performing the transmission based on the measured CR, wherein the interval in the predetermined size includes both a past time interval and a future time interval with reference to a timing at which the user equipment measures the number of the subchannels.
